About This Clinic

Health Services accepts DC Medicaid, Medicare, DCHealthcare Alliance, Amerigroup, HealthRight, Chartered, MarylandMedicaid and private insurance.

Currently, we are only taking new Blue Cross  Blue Shield HMO patients with Dr. Vaughn.

For patients without insurance we have a sliding fee scale based on income,as well as an on-staff Enrollment Specialist who will help you to signup for benefits.

Walk-in services are available for established patients with urgent issues only. 

Walk-in services are not available for new patients or established patients that have not been to the clinic for services in 3 years or more. 

Please call (202) 232-9022 for additional information.

2026 US Federal Poverty Guidelines

for the 48 contiguous states and the District of Columbia

Persons in family / household Poverty guideline
1 $15,960
2 $21,640
3 $27,320
4 $33,000
5 $38,680
6 $44,360
7 $50,040
8 $55,720

For families/households with more than 8 persons, add $5,140 for each additional person.

About Free & Low-Cost Dental Clinics

Across the United States, free and low-cost dental clinics play a vital role in making oral healthcare reachable for everyone. Supported by government funding, non-profit organisations, and charitable contributions, these clinics deliver essential dental treatment to those who need it most — including uninsured individuals, low-income families, children, seniors, and people receiving government assistance.
